首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PLSQL -参数类型或数量错误

PL/SQL是一种过程化编程语言,用于Oracle数据库管理系统中的存储过程、触发器、函数等对象的开发和管理。它是一种结合了SQL语句和编程语言特性的强大工具,可以实现复杂的数据处理和业务逻辑。

PL/SQL的参数类型或数量错误是指在调用存储过程、触发器或函数时,提供的参数与定义的参数类型或数量不匹配,导致错误的情况。这种错误可能会导致程序无法正常执行或返回错误的结果。

为了解决参数类型或数量错误,可以采取以下步骤:

  1. 检查参数数量:确保提供的参数数量与定义的参数数量一致。如果参数数量不匹配,可以修改调用代码或存储过程/函数的定义,以确保它们匹配。
  2. 检查参数类型:确保提供的参数类型与定义的参数类型一致。如果参数类型不匹配,可以尝试进行类型转换或修改参数定义,以确保它们匹配。
  3. 检查参数顺序:确保提供的参数顺序与定义的参数顺序一致。如果参数顺序不匹配,可以修改调用代码或存储过程/函数的定义,以确保它们匹配。
  4. 使用命名参数:如果存在多个参数且顺序容易混淆,可以使用命名参数来明确指定参数的名称和值,以避免参数顺序错误。
  5. 检查参数值:确保提供的参数值符合定义的约束条件,例如长度、范围等。如果参数值不符合约束条件,可以修改参数值或修改约束条件。

腾讯云提供了一系列与Oracle数据库相关的产品和服务,例如云数据库Oracle版、弹性公网IP、云服务器等,可以帮助用户在云环境中进行PL/SQL开发和部署。具体产品介绍和相关链接如下:

  1. 云数据库Oracle版:提供稳定可靠的Oracle数据库服务,支持高可用、备份恢复、性能优化等功能。了解更多:https://cloud.tencent.com/product/cdb_oracle
  2. 弹性公网IP:为云服务器提供公网访问能力,可用于与外部系统进行数据交互。了解更多:https://cloud.tencent.com/product/eip
  3. 云服务器:提供灵活可扩展的虚拟服务器,可用于部署和运行PL/SQL代码。了解更多:https://cloud.tencent.com/product/cvm

通过使用腾讯云的相关产品和服务,用户可以在云计算环境中高效地开发、部署和管理PL/SQL代码,实现数据处理和业务逻辑的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券